Exact date/time display not working for timestmamp of comments, only for timestamps of card title #4192

Closed
Alphaphi15 opened this issue Nov 7, 2022 · 5 comments · Fixed by #5253

Comments

@Alphaphi15
Copy link

Alphaphi15 commented Nov 7, 2022

Bug description:
Date/timestamp of the creation date of a deck card is displayed correctly when hovering with the mouse over the title. But the date/timestamp is NOT displayed when hovering with the mouse over the field "X mins/days/months ago" right to a comment.

To reproduce:
Create a card in deck. Open the card, go to comments, and add a comment. Save the comment.
Hover with the mouse over the title. In addition to "created a min ago / changed a min ago", a bubble text with the exact created/changed timestamp is displayed.
Hover with the mouse over the field right to the commend. No exact timestamp is desplayed in addition of "1 minute ago".

Expected behavior:
A bubble text with the exact timestamp should be displayed.

Screenshot
221107-Screenshot

Client details:

  • Linux
  • Firefox 106.0.5
  • Nextcloud 24.0.5 as provided by Hetzner (Storage Share)
